How to buy bitcoin? Can it be bought using IBKR or other brokers?

Can bitcoin be bought by IBKR? For buy and hold long term.

Unfortunately, you can’t buy Bitcoin or other cryptocurrencies from traditional brokers like IBKR. Traditional brokers give you access to stock markets, and Bitcoin is not traded on the stock market.

You’ll have to buy Bitcoin on a cryptocurrency exchange instead. There are plenty out there, so it can get overwhelming. I’ve found Binance Singapore and Coinhako which you can use for a start. Binance Singapore offers better rates but does not allow for direct bank transfers (you’ll have to go through an intermediary called xfers) and does not have a mobile app (Binance Global does). On the other hand, Coinhako has a better UI, has direct bank transfers, but worse rates.

Also, if you’re planning to buy and hold long term (called HODL in cryptocurrencies), especially if you have large amounts, I would highly recommend withdrawing your coins from the exchange for better security. For a start you can withdraw it to a hot wallet and once you research more you can withdraw it to a cold wallet.
